Hadju-Cheney syndrome is an extremely rare genetic disorder of the connective tissue characterized by severe and excessive bone resorption leading to osteoporosis and a wide range of other potential symptoms. Approximately 50 cases have been reported worldwide.
Since about 2002, some patients with this disorder have been offered drug therapy with bisphosphonates (a class of osteoporosis drugs) to treat problems with bone resorption associated with the bone breakdown and skeletal malformations that characterize this disorder.
